Sleepy Hollow and "The True Blood Effect"

Season one of Sleepy Hollow, I got. I liked it a lot. I understood where the main character came from as I was force-fed the origin story in mini form during the opening title sequence. The stories were derived from Ichabod's experiences intertwining him within American history. And the ultimate goal was to defeat the four horsemen of the apocalypse.

And then season two... what happened? I want to call it "The True Blood Effect", where anything and everything can happen to the main characters in reality or in the supernatural worlds and, oh, lets add new characters, too. Boo! The witchy stuff turned supernatural. The fight of good over evil turned satanic. Ichabod becomes disillusioned by his witch/wife who was stuck in purgatory; a place that now the main characters can travel in and out of through mirrors.
